In the early stages of a brokerage, working with new carriers for every load can feel normal. It offers flexibility and allows brokers to cover shipments quickly. However, as volume grows, this approach becomes harder to sustain. Scaling a brokerage is not just about moving more vehicles, it is about moving more vehicles without increasing chaos. Repeat carriers play a major role in making that possible.
đźšš Scaling Requires Predictability, Not Just Volume
Growth in auto transport does not come from booking more car shipments alone. It comes from building systems that allow brokers to handle higher volume without increasing stress and risk.
When brokers rely only on new carriers, every load requires extra verification, communication and follow-up. Over time, this slows operations and limits growth potential. Working with repeat partners creates predictable workflows and reduces uncertainty.
📞 Familiar Communication Speeds Up Operations
Communication improves significantly when brokers and carriers work together regularly. Expectations become clearer, updates arrive earlier and fewer misunderstandings occur. With repeat partnerships:
Dispatch processes become familiar
Pickup and delivery coordination improves
Fewer calls are needed to confirm details
This efficiency allows brokers to manage more loads without adding extra administrative work.
đź§ Known Performance Improves Planning
When brokers work with familiar carriers, they learn how those carriers perform on specific routes. This knowledge helps brokers plan more accurately and provide realistic timelines to customers. Predictable performance supports:
More accurate quoting
Better ETA expectations
Stronger customer confidence
This level of planning becomes essential as brokerage volume increases.
đź’¸ Reduced Rebooking Protects Margins
Rebooking is one of the biggest obstacles to scaling efficiently. When a carrier cancels or fails to perform, brokers must find new coverage quickly, often at higher rates.
Repeat carriers significantly reduce this risk. Reliable partnerships lead to fewer cancellations and more dependable service, which protects margins and reduces operational stress.
🤝 Capacity Becomes Easier to Secure
As demand increases, carriers naturally prioritize brokers they trust and work with consistently. Repeat relationships often result in better access to available trucks during busy periods.
This stability allows brokers to maintain service quality even when the market becomes competitive.
